Choosing the right work glove is about more than finding a pair that looks durable. Cut-Resistant Work Gloves for Men need to fit properly so they can provide protection without limiting movement, grip, or comfort. A glove that is too loose may slide around, while one that is too tight can cause pressure, fatigue, and restricted hand movement.

The ideal fit should feel secure but not restrictive. Your fingers should reach the ends of the glove without being compressed, and the palm should sit smoothly against the material. Whether you work in construction, manufacturing, metal handling, woodworking, automotive repair, or warehouse operations, proper sizing can make a major difference in both safety and productivity.
This guide explains how work gloves should fit, how to measure your hands, what to look for when trying them on, and how different glove features affect fit.
Why Proper Glove Fit Matters
Work gloves are designed to protect your hands from specific workplace hazards. However, protection is only useful when the gloves stay correctly positioned during work.
A glove that fits properly allows you to grip tools naturally. It also helps maintain finger control when handling small components, machinery, materials, or equipment.
Poor fit can create several problems.
Loose gloves can move independently from your hands. This movement may reduce grip and make precise tasks harder. Excess material around the fingers can also become inconvenient when working with tools or machinery.
Tight gloves create a different set of problems. They can restrict circulation and make your hands tired. Constant pressure around the fingertips or knuckles may also become uncomfortable during long shifts.
The right fit provides a balance between protection, dexterity, comfort, and movement.
What Should a Properly Fitted Work Glove Feel Like?
A properly fitted glove should feel like a natural extension of your hand.
The palm should make consistent contact with the glove material. There should not be large empty spaces between your hand and the palm surface.
Your fingers should reach comfortably toward the ends of each finger pocket. A small amount of room is acceptable, but your fingertips should not sit far below the ends.
The glove should also allow you to make a relaxed fist without excessive pulling across the back of your hand.
When you open and close your hand, the material should move with your fingers rather than sliding significantly.
The Fingertips
Fingertip fit is one of the easiest ways to identify whether a glove is the correct size.
Your fingertips should sit close to the ends of the glove fingers. However, they should not be forced firmly against the material.
If your fingers press against the ends when your hand is relaxed, the glove may be too small.
If there is a noticeable pocket of unused material at the fingertips, the glove may be too large.
For tasks requiring precision, excessive fingertip space can interfere with control.
The Palm
The palm should fit securely without feeling squeezed.
A properly sized glove should cover your entire palm and provide sufficient protection around the base of your fingers.
When you bend your fingers, the palm material should flex naturally. It should not pull so tightly that movement becomes uncomfortable.
A glove with excess palm material can also affect grip. Material that bunches underneath your hand may make it harder to hold tools securely.
The Knuckles
The knuckle area needs enough flexibility for repeated movement.
Make a fist while wearing the gloves. The material should stretch or flex naturally around your knuckles.
If you feel strong pressure across the knuckles, try a larger size or a different glove design.
If the glove becomes extremely loose around the knuckles when your hand is open, it may be too large.
How to Measure Your Hand for Work Gloves
The most reliable way to find your size is to measure your hand before purchasing.
You generally need to measure either the circumference of your dominant hand or its length, depending on the manufacturer's sizing chart.
Use a flexible measuring tape if possible.
Measuring Hand Circumference
Wrap the measuring tape around the widest part of your hand, usually across the knuckles.
Do not include your thumb.
Keep the tape comfortably snug. It should touch your hand without squeezing it.
Record the measurement in inches or centimeters.
Compare this measurement with the manufacturer's sizing chart.
Different manufacturers may use different measurements for small, medium, large, extra-large, and other sizes. Never assume that a large glove from one company will fit exactly like a large glove from another.
Measuring Hand Length
Place your hand flat with your fingers together.
Measure from the tip of your middle finger down to the crease where your wrist begins.
Record the measurement.
Some manufacturers use hand length as the primary sizing measurement, while others use palm circumference.
When both measurements are available, compare both with the manufacturer's chart.
Should Work Gloves Be Tight or Loose?
Work gloves should generally be snug rather than tight or loose.
A snug glove stays in position while allowing your fingers to move naturally.
You should be able to open your hand, close it into a fist, bend each finger, and grip an object without significant restriction.
A glove that is tight enough to leave deep pressure marks after normal use may not be appropriate.
On the other hand, a glove that shifts noticeably whenever you move your hand is probably too loose.
The correct fit depends somewhat on the task. A precision job may require a closer fit, while certain heavy-duty applications may allow slightly more room.
How Much Room Should Be at the Fingertips?
There should be minimal excess space at the fingertips.
Your fingers should not be jammed against the glove ends. At the same time, there should not be a large empty section.
A little flexibility at the end can be useful because hands naturally change position during work.
If your fingertips slide backward whenever you grip something, the glove may be too large.
This can reduce dexterity and make repetitive tasks more difficult.
How Cut Resistance Affects Glove Fit
Cut-resistant materials can feel different from ordinary work glove fabrics.
Many protective gloves use high-performance fibers, engineered yarns, or reinforced materials. These materials are designed to resist cuts while maintaining flexibility.
However, increased protection does not mean the glove should feel stiff or oversized.
A well-designed cut-resistant glove should allow natural hand movement appropriate to its protection level.
When evaluating Cut-Resistant Work Gloves for Men, consider both the cut-resistance rating and the fit. A highly protective glove that prevents you from safely controlling a tool may not be the best choice for a particular task.
Always choose protection based on the actual workplace hazard.
How to Test the Fit Before Working
Trying on gloves for a few seconds is useful, but performing several simple movements provides a better assessment.
Start by opening your hand completely.
Check whether the material pulls across your fingers or palm.
Next, make a fist.
The glove should flex naturally without excessive pressure.
Then spread your fingers apart.
Look for uncomfortable tension between the fingers.
Finally, simulate your normal work movements. If you regularly hold tools, pick up materials, operate equipment, or handle small components, perform those motions while wearing the gloves.
Grip Test
Hold a tool or another object similar to what you use at work.
Check whether your hand can maintain a secure grip.
The glove should not rotate around your hand.
If the glove moves when you squeeze the object, it may be too loose.
A properly fitted glove should support your grip rather than interfere with it.
Dexterity Test
Try picking up a small object.
Move your fingers individually.
If you struggle to manipulate the object because of excess material or stiffness, the glove may not be suitable for precision work.
Remember that different glove designs provide different levels of dexterity.
Common Signs Your Gloves Are Too Small
Several warning signs can indicate that your gloves are undersized.
Your fingertips may press firmly against the ends.
The material may pull strongly when you make a fist.
You may experience pressure around the knuckles.
The seams may feel uncomfortable.
Your hands may become tired quickly.
You may also notice restricted movement when spreading your fingers.
These signs indicate that you should consider a larger size or another glove design.
Do not rely on stretching the gloves to solve a serious sizing problem. Protective gloves should fit correctly from the beginning.
Common Signs Your Gloves Are Too Large
Oversized gloves have their own problems.
Excess material may gather around the fingertips.
The glove may slide toward the wrist.
The palm may not remain aligned with your hand.
You may lose precision when handling small objects.
The glove may rotate while you work.
These issues are especially important during tasks that require controlled movements.
If you frequently have to pull your gloves back into position, the fit should be reassessed.
Do Men Need a Different Glove Fit?
Men's hands are often larger on average, but hand size varies considerably between individuals.
The best approach is to select gloves according to actual hand measurements rather than relying only on gender-based sizing.
Manufacturers may label products specifically for men, but the sizing chart remains the most important guide.
Hand width, finger length, palm circumference, and overall proportions can vary significantly.
Someone with broad palms may need a different size from someone with long, narrow fingers, even if both have similar hand lengths.
How Glove Materials Influence Fit
Material affects how a glove feels during movement.
Knitted gloves may offer considerable flexibility because they can stretch around the hand.
Coated gloves can provide additional grip and protection while maintaining a relatively close fit.
Leather gloves may feel more structured and can change slightly with use.
Reinforced gloves may have additional material in high-wear areas, which can affect flexibility.
When selecting Cut-Resistant Work Gloves for Men, consider the balance between material construction and the movements your job requires.

Can Gloves Become Loose Over Time?
Some gloves may change slightly after repeated use.
Materials can stretch, soften, or become worn.
Sweat, washing, heat, and mechanical wear can also affect the structure of the glove.
A glove that originally fit securely may eventually become loose.
Inspect your gloves regularly.
If the material has stretched significantly, seams are damaged, or the glove no longer stays in place, replacement may be necessary.
Follow the manufacturer's cleaning and care instructions to help maintain the intended fit.
Should You Size Up for Comfort?
Sizing up is not always the best solution for comfort.
If a glove feels tight because the design is incompatible with your hand shape, choosing a larger size may create excessive fingertip space.
Instead, look for a different model with a more suitable cut or construction.
Comfort should come from proper sizing and appropriate design rather than simply adding extra space.
Choosing the Right Size When Between Sizes
Sometimes your measurements fall between two sizes.
In that situation, consider the manufacturer's recommendations first.
Think about your work requirements as well.
If you need high dexterity and precise control, a closer fit may be preferable, provided it does not restrict movement.
For applications where you need additional room or wear a thin liner underneath, the larger size may be more appropriate.
Do not choose based solely on the label. Try to match the glove to both your hand measurements and your job.
Final Checklist for a Proper Fit
Before using your gloves on the job, check the following:
- Your fingertips reach close to the glove ends.
- Your fingers are not pressed tightly against the material.
- The palm fits smoothly.
- The glove does not rotate around your hand.
- You can make a fist comfortably.
- You can spread your fingers naturally.
- Your wrist remains comfortably covered.
- You can grip your usual tools securely.
- There is no excessive bunching.
- The glove remains in place during movement.
If these conditions are met, the glove is likely to provide a comfortable and functional fit.
